Simple, Low Cost Thermostatic Baths
from Huber… The new Huber MPC (Micro Processor Control), available from Radleys, is a modern, low cost immersion circulator which has been purposely designed with basic func - tionalities - so you only pay for what you need.
The MPC immersion circulators operate across the temperature range of -30°C to +200°C and combine with either polycarbonate or stainless steel baths to provide precision heating and cooling for both routine and sensitive laboratory procedures.
The MPC controller has a large temperature display, LED indicators for the pump and three easy to use keys for a simple user interface. As with all Huber thermostatic devices, safety is a priority; with the MPC range featuring over temperature alarm and low-liquid level protection. All MPC models also feature a powerful pressure and suction pump for optimum performance.
For customers requiring more functionality, the MPC is available in an advanced version, which offers the added benefits of an RS232 interface, as well as the facility for using an external sensor.
The MPC immersion circulator can be purchased on its own or with a bath. Baths are available in different materials, and sizes from 6 to 25 litres. The polycarbonate baths are transparent with operating temperatures up to 100°C. The insulated stainless steel baths have a maximum working temperature of 200°C. For sub-ambient applications the MPC can be combined with a refrigerated bath.

Making your Chemistry Safer, Cleaner and Faster…
The Heat-On range, available from Radleys, is an easy to use heating and stirring work station. Designed to accept standard round bottom flasks from 10ml to 5 litres, they are the safest, fastest most efficient way of heating and stirring a round bottom flask…
The risk of oil fires and injury from hot oil spills, plus the mess and disposal costs associates with the use of oil, mean that oil bathes are no longer considered safe or environmentally friendly working practice in labs. Heat-On reduces the risks by offering a safe, cost effective and high performance alternative to heating round bottom flasks. For additional safety optional lifting handles can easily be attached and removed allowing the user to remove the block from the heat source even whilst it remains hot.
Manufactured from solid aluminium, Heat-On provides even heat transfer to the entire block, preventing hot spots. The unique deep well shape has been proven to avoid sticking and cracking of flasks maximising the heating surface area further contributing to faster heat-up. Heat-On is available with an innovative Fluoropolymer coating that gives superb chemical resistance to most solvents and alkalis and extends the product life, but if preferred, a standard lower cost anodised finish is also available.
The weight saving design of Heat-On reduces the thermal mass of the block, making heat up times significantly faster. Tests have shown that Heat-On can boil a 250ml flask of water in under 11 minutes making them faster and more efficient than oil bathes or other competitive blocks. As well as providing up to 66% faster heat-up than traditional heating blocks the advanced design of Heat-On blocks uses 30% less energy to achieve the same results, saving money and reducing the environmental impact of your experiments.

Circle no. 602 Accurate and Reproducible Control of Polymerisation Experiments
Radleys have published a Technical Bulletin that demonstrates how the Lara™ Controlled Laboratory Reactor (CLR) is able to accurately and reproducibly control polymerisation experiments.
The new application note describes a series of experiments in which the Lara CLR was used to automatically control the addition of monomer, initiator and reagent where both linear and variable rates of addition of feed materials were employed.
The
experiments demonstrate that the Lara CLR can be used to automatically ensure that the molecular weight and structure of the resulting polymer can be predicted, controlled and reproduced.
The first experiment was run with a predetermined increasing monomer addition rate. The second experiment was run with a linear rate of monomer addition and a decreasing variable rate of initiator addition. In both experiments the monomer addition rate was gradually increased over several hours to ensure that the relative
concentration of monomer stayed constant throughout the multiple feed step of the reaction. As the test polymerisation reaction was exothermic, the experiments included the use of feedback loops to ensure safe and controlled additions.
Lara is a flexible, modular CLR unit which enables rapid interchange of glass vessels from 100ml to 10 litre and the integration of third party devices such as circulators, pumps, balances, syringe pumps etc making it the idea process development tool. Lara’s intuitive, easy- to-use; drag-and-drop software allows full control and data logging of all devices and parameters.

Drawing upon over 40 year’s experience, Radleys have established an international reputation for supplying high quality custom scientific glassware. At a modern and well equipped manufacturing facility in Saffron Walden, UK - Radleys experienced team of highly skilled glassblowers and product specialists have the experience and knowledge to assist in all aspects from the design stage through to manufacture. All technical advice and quotations, irrespective of the complexity of design, is given free of charge.
Ongoing investment in the latest manufacturing equipment and machine tools allows us to rapidly produce specially designed one-off pieces of glassware, or large numbers of conventional laboratory glassware items in a single manufacturing run. Access to a large team of highly skilled scientific glassblowers gives Radleys the capacity to deal with even the most urgent glassblowing projects or repair.
Radleys specialist services include design, borosilicate and quartz glassblowing, prototype and development projects, graduating, grinding and cutting, enamel transfers, amber staining and plastic coating, installation of large systems or complex assemblies, vacuum work and glassware safety audits. Customers benefit from Radleys’ vast knowledge of glassware fittings, components, materials and manufacturing methods. Radleys’ custom scientific glassware can be supplied certified to ASTM, BP, EP and USP standards.
